Princess Leonor & Infanta Sofía: The Next Generation of Royal Style Icons
Princess Leonor has naturally absorbed her mother’s style ethos:
- At the Marivent Palace summer reception, she borrowed a blue-and-white off-the-shoulder dress from Queen Letizia’s previous wardrobe and styled it with her mother’s iconic espadrille wedges—a thoughtful nod to inherited elegance.
Infanta Sofía also shines in her own right. At the same event, she opted for a youthful pink tie-dye dress with espadrilles, striking a balance between playful and poised.

Q: What are espadrille wedges, and why are they iconic?
Espadrilles are traditional Spanish summer shoes often made of canvas or cotton fabric with woven soles—perfect for stylish comfort in warm climates. The Letizia wedges blend heritage with modern sensibility.
